Proposal for Revision of Uighur Romanization Table
11/05/14
A proposal to revise the Uighur romanization table has been submitted to the Library of
Congress and is available for review at

The objectives of this revision are fourfold:
* 1. The existing rules were occasionally confusing and conflicting (e.g. Rule 2) and
hampered reversibility (Rules 2, 6, 7, and 9).
* 2. The letters "i" and "y" are distinct in Uighur and should be
distinct in Romanization.
* 3. Medial hamzah should be romanized ' (alif).
* 4. The new table is now almost completely reversible.
